你查询的IP:[117.22.139.75]  地理位置:中国–陕西–西安

最新查询114.60.191.88 125.62.41.161 60.63.17.54 117.112.47.80 60.63.179.109 125.215.145.33 124.66.158.59 123.64.168.70 58.66.177.100 117.22.139.75 58.87.64.26 210.52.201.201 116.90.184.81 124.88.100.122 202.38.158.28 120.192.233.16 119.62.72.140 203.89.155.65 122.198.230.176 119.31.192.224 210.5.64.247 119.161.128.12 210.82.64.0 203.196.116.234 202.124.24.222 121.76.24.77 121.40.128.50 202.14.236.42 202.131.48.214 118.184.4.249 124.47.134.240